The Department of Medicine is committed to providing career planning and development for our faculty and trainees to thrive in their roles as clinicians, researchers, educators, mentors, and leaders. We offer these resources through our faculty development program, led by Dr. Gerard Silvestri, the Senior Vice Chair for Faculty Development. Dr. Silvestri's priority and focus is the academic success of every faculty member in the department, which he aims to achieve through the following:
Our goals and responsibilities include:
- Promote rewarding and sustainable mentoring relationships through mentorship training, support tools, and oversight
- Enhance faculty scholarship through educational programs in scientific writing, grant proposal development, and project development
- Provide support and resources to aid faculty in the annual promotion and tenure process
- Assist with the recruitment and retention of faculty from a wide variety of backgrounds and multicultural experiences
- Connect faculty to relevant intramural/extramural career development programs and awards
